阿里实时音视频如何实现音视频混音?

在当今这个数字化、网络化的时代,音视频技术已经深入到我们的工作和生活中。而作为国内领先的互联网公司,阿里巴巴的实时音视频技术更是备受瞩目。那么,阿里实时音视频是如何实现音视频混音的呢?本文将为您揭开这一神秘的面纱。

一、音视频混音技术概述

音视频混音是指将多个音视频源合并为一个音视频流的过程。在阿里实时音视频技术中,混音功能可以满足用户在直播、会议、游戏等场景下的需求,提高音视频传输的效率和质量。

二、阿里实时音视频混音技术原理

阿里实时音视频的混音技术主要基于以下原理:

  1. 音频编解码:首先,对各个音视频源的音频信号进行编解码,将其转换为统一的音频格式。

  2. 音频混合:将编解码后的音频信号进行混合,实现音视频同步播放。

  3. 音频降噪:在混音过程中,利用先进的降噪算法,去除音频中的噪声,提高音质。

  4. 音频增益:根据音视频源的音量大小,对音频信号进行增益处理,确保音量均衡。

  5. 音频回声消除:通过算法检测并消除音频中的回声,提升通话质量。

三、案例分析

以阿里实时音视频在直播场景中的应用为例,我们可以看到混音技术发挥的重要作用。

假设有一场直播活动,主持人需要在现场与观众互动。此时,主持人需要通过实时音视频技术将自己的声音与现场音、观众评论等音视频源进行混音。通过阿里实时音视频的混音技术,可以将主持人声音与现场音、观众评论等音视频源进行同步播放,确保直播过程流畅、音质清晰。

四、总结

阿里实时音视频的混音技术,通过音频编解码、音频混合、音频降噪、音频增益、音频回声消除等环节,实现了音视频源的高效混音。这一技术在直播、会议、游戏等场景中得到了广泛应用,为用户带来了更好的音视频体验。未来,随着音视频技术的不断发展,阿里实时音视频的混音技术也将不断创新,为用户带来更多惊喜。

猜你喜欢:小游戏开发